Common questions about Frovatriptan (FAQ)
Q: What is Frovatriptan used for, besides treating migraines?
A: Regulatory documents state that Frovatriptan is specifically indicated only for the acute treatment of established migraine headaches in adults. It works to relieve the pain and symptoms of a migraine attack once it has started. It should not be used for other types of pain, such as regular headaches or generalized body aches.
Q: Is Frovatriptan a painkiller or something different?
A: Frovatriptan is classified as a selective serotonin receptor agonist (triptan). This means it targets specific chemical receptors to modulate biological mechanisms associated with migraine. It is not classified as an ordinary pain reliever, which differentiates its mechanism of action.
Q: Can Frovatriptan be used for tension headaches?
A: Official usage guidelines specify that Frovatriptan is approved only for treating a diagnosed migraine attack. Regulatory documents state that use is restricted to diagnosed migraine attacks. Patients are cautioned against using it for any type of headache that is different from their usual migraine, including tension headaches.
Q: How quickly does Frovatriptan usually start to work?
A: Studies that examined the effect of Frovatriptan showed statistically significant relief starting around 2 hours after administration. Clinical studies observed an improved response when measured at the 4-hour mark. This timeframe aligns with the drug's absorption, as its maximum concentration in the blood is typically reached within 2 to 3 hours.
Q: How long can the effect of Frovatriptan last?
A: The effect of Frovatriptan can be sustained due to its long terminal half-life, which averages approximately 26 hours. This characteristic is generally linked to a lower rate of headache recurrence compared to some shorter-acting triptans, helping to maintain the pain-free status over a longer period.
Q: Does Frovatriptan cause drowsiness or affect driving?
A: Regulatory warnings state that common side effects can include feelings of dizziness and fatigue. Regulatory labeling includes a warning not to drive or operate machinery until the patient knows how the medicine affects them and their specific reaction.

Q: What is the difference between Frovatriptan and Sumatriptan?
A: Frovatriptan is structurally distinct but operates in the same drug class as Sumatriptan and other triptans. A key distinguishing feature highlighted in regulatory-supported literature is Frovatriptan’s long terminal half-life of around 26 hours. This longer presence in the body is associated with a lower rate of headache recurrence following initial relief.
Q: Are there any specific foods or drinks that should be avoided when taking Frovatriptan?
A: Official pharmacokinetic information states that Frovatriptan may be taken with or without food. Regulatory information does not list specific food restrictions that must be followed when using this medicine.
Q: Is it necessary to avoid alcohol completely while using Frovatriptan?
A: Official studies show that moderate alcohol consumption does not affect the way Frovatriptan is concentrated in the body. However, regulatory guidance states that combining the medicine with alcohol may increase the risk of experiencing side effects such as dizziness or feeling lightheaded.
Q: Are there studies comparing Frovatriptan's effectiveness in men versus women?
A: Pharmacokinetic data indicates that Frovatriptan concentrations in the blood are consistently higher in women than in men. However, official information clarifies that this difference is not considered clinically significant. Therefore, official documents confirm that efficacy is expected across both populations.
Q: Does Frovatriptan interact with herbal remedies like St. John's Wort?
A: Official warnings indicate that the use of Frovatriptan with products that affect serotonin levels may increase the theoretical risk of Serotonin Syndrome. This includes certain herbal products, and Frovatriptan should be administered with caution alongside them.

Q: Is it possible to have an allergic reaction to Frovatriptan?
A: Yes, allergic reactions are possible, and regulatory documents list serious anaphylactic reactions as a documented event. For this reason, Frovatriptan is officially contraindicated for anyone who is known to be hypersensitive or allergic to the drug itself or any of its components.
Q: Are there any reports of Frovatriptan affecting mood or causing anxiety?
A: Regulatory adverse reaction lists confirm that Frovatriptan can possibly affect mood. Anxiety, depression, confusion, and agitation are all listed as uncommon side effects documented in official product information.
Q: Can people with high cholesterol safely use Frovatriptan?
A: Official regulatory documents list high cholesterol (hypercholesterolemia) as one of several established cardiovascular risk factors. If a patient has multiple such risk factors, official documents require a cardiovascular evaluation to be performed before beginning therapy with Frovatriptan.
Q: Is it correct that Frovatriptan is structurally different from other triptans?
A: Official chemical descriptions state that Frovatriptan is structurally distinct from other agents in the triptan class. Despite this structural difference, it is classified as pharmacologically related because it works on the same specific serotonin receptors.
Q: Are there specific symptoms that mean I should stop taking Frovatriptan and seek immediate help?
A: Regulatory patient counseling information identifies symptoms that indicate a need for immediate medical assistance. These include severe chest pain or tightness, sudden numbness or weakness, slurring of speech, or severe abdominal pain. In the event such symptoms occur, official guidance states that the use of Frovatriptan should cease.
Q: Can a person be ineligible for Frovatriptan based on their family medical history?
A: Regulatory documents list a family history of coronary artery disease (CAD) as one of the established cardiovascular risk factors. If a person has this history along with other risk factors, official documents state that a cardiovascular evaluation must be completed before treatment can begin.
Q: Is Frovatriptan used to treat cluster headaches?
A: According to official regulatory documents, Frovatriptan is indicated only for the acute treatment of migraine headaches in adults. It is not approved or indicated for use in treating other types of severe headaches, such as cluster headaches.
Q: Can Frovatriptan be taken if I also take a blood pressure medicine?
A: Frovatriptan is contraindicated in patients with uncontrolled hypertension (high blood pressure). Additionally, it is documented to interact with certain blood pressure medicines, like propranolol, which can increase its concentration in the body. This information is based on official drug interaction studies.

Q: Does taking Frovatriptan affect how other medicines are processed by the body?
A: Official pharmacokinetic studies indicate that Frovatriptan is unlikely to alter the way other medicines are processed in the body. This is because the drug has been shown to have a low potential for affecting the common drug-metabolizing enzymes.
